3. Highlight Relevant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

Identify the key performance indicators (KPIs) that matter most to your audience. Investors may be interested in metrics like return on investment (ROI) and internal rate of return (IRR).

Lenders, on the other hand, may prioritize factors such as debt service coverage ratio (DSCR) and loan-to-value ratio (LTV). By emphasizing these relevant KPIs, you can effectively communicate the value and potential of your business or investment.

4. Customize Financial Projections and Forecasts

A comprehensive business plan includes financial projections and forecasts. However, to tailor your plan to different audiences, it’s crucial to customize these financial aspects. Highlight the numbers that are most important to your target stakeholders.

For investors, focus on revenue growth, profitability, and return on investment. For lenders, emphasize cash flow stability, collateral value, and debt repayment capacity. By tailoring your financial projections, you showcase the specific financial benefits that resonate with each audience.

5. Showcase Market Research and Competitive Analysis

Incorporating thorough market research and competitive analysis is a key component of a compelling business plan. However, the focus and depth of this information may vary depending on the stakeholders involved. Investors may appreciate detailed market sizing, growth potential, and industry trends.

On the other hand, buyers may be more interested in local market dynamics, target demographics, and competitive advantages. Tailor your research and analysis to provide the most valuable insights specific to your audience’s interests and priorities.

6. Emphasize Risk Management Strategies

Risk management is a critical consideration for all stakeholders. When presenting your business plan, make sure to address their risk concerns and highlight the strategies you have in place to mitigate potential risks.

Investors will want to understand how you manage financial and market risks, while lenders may focus on collateral and loan security. Tailor your risk management section to provide reassurance and instill confidence in your audience.
